Meaning of
jaan-e-be-baha
जान-ए-बे-बहा • جان بے بہا
English
priceless beloved; invaluable essence
Hindi
अनमोल प्रिय; बेशकीमती सार
Urdu
بے قیمت محبوب; انمول جوہر
Origin
Persian
Nuance
The phrase 'jaan-e-be-baha' evokes the idea of a beloved whose worth is beyond measure. In poetry, this term often captures the essence of a love so profound that it transcends material value, becoming a symbol of ultimate devotion and sacrifice.
Poetic Usage
Poets use 'jaan-e-be-baha' to express an unparalleled love. It often appears in verses where the beloved is compared to treasures or celestial entities. The term can also highlight the contrast between worldly possessions and the true wealth of the heart.
